5 U.S.C. § 8150

U.S. CodeFederalPositive Law
Effect on other statutes

(a) This subchapter does not affect the maritime rights and remedies of a master or member of the crew of a vessel. (b) Section 8141 of this title and section 9491 of title 10 do not confer military or veteran status on any individual. (Pub. L. 89–554, Sept. 6, 1966, 80 Stat. 555; Pub. L. 115–232, div. A, title VIII, § 809(c)(4), Aug. 13, 2018, 132 Stat. 1841.) Historical and Revision Notes DerivationU.S. CodeRevised Statutes andStatutes at Large (a)5 U.S.C. 791–4(b).Oct. 14, 1949, ch. 691, § 305(b), 63 Stat. 868. (b)5 U.S.C. 803a.Aug. 3, 1956, ch. 926, § 1 “Sec. 4”, 70 Stat. 981. Standard changes are made to conform with the definitions applicable and the style of this title as outlined in the preface to the report. Editorial Notes Amendments2018—Subsec. (b). Pub. L. 115–232 substituted “section 9491 of title 10” for “section 9441 of title 10”. Statutory Notes and Related Subsidiaries Effective Date of 2018 AmendmentAmendment by Pub. L. 115–232 effective Feb. 1, 2019, with provision for the coordination of amendments and special rule for certain redesignations, see section 800 of Pub. L. 115–232, set out as a note preceding section 3001 of Title 10, Armed Forces.
